On Friday 16 December 2011 13:49:15 Moffett, Kyle D wrote: > On Dec 16, 2011, at 00:05, Mike Frysinger wrote: > > On Thursday 15 December 2011 22:32:41 Kyle Moffett wrote: > >> This new #define is set in config_cmd_defaults.h (which is automatically > >> included on every board by "mkconfig"), but this allows boards to elect > >> to omit the "reset" command if necessary with "#undef CONFIG_CMD_RESET". > > > > NAK: doesn't seem to address the feedback i posted last time ... > > Hmm, I thought I addressed these: > >> --- a/include/config_cmd_defaults.h > >> +++ b/include/config_cmd_defaults.h > > > > updating these files is not sufficient and will break boards. drop the > > hunks to these files and update include/config_defaults.h instead. > > The "mkconfig" program automatically includes both config_defaults.h and > config_cmd_defaults.h, so this is sufficient to not break boards.
ah, you're right. sorry about that. i was thinking of "config_cmd_default.h" which is not the same as "config_cmd_defaults.h" ;). > > would be a good time to split this into a dedicated common/cmd_reset.c, > > we can also then fix cmd_boot.c to only build when CONFIG_CMD_GO is > > enabled > > The only references to CONFIG_CMD_GO are in config_cmd_defaults.h, README, > and common/cmd_boot.c, there is nothing that ever turns it off, so perhaps > the config symbol should just be removed? i have some boards that turn it off -mike
